Manufacturing & Fabrication of Wood & Millwork – Passively Owned
Backlog over $6M & includes over $2.6M in assets!
Specifications
Presenting a manufacturing & fabrication company with a focus in wood and millwork where the owner is very much passive. They are boasting more than $6M in backlog and the asset value is over $2.6M; which includes a working capital of $1.8M, vehicles and equipment over $800,000. They have a recurring client base which consists of schools, universities, churches, and hospitals. They do not carry any designations such as MBE, WBE, or SDVOSB. The business owner enjoys running this company passively due to the experienced leadership team of 5 which includes a President who has been groomed to operate the business, 7 Administrators, 9 in the shop, and 6 in the field. Labor includes the General Manager, Foreman, Estimator, Production Manager, and Fabricators with all other labor subcontracted out for installation. The owner is willing to stay on for 1 year and is selling due to retirement as he established this business more than 30 years ago. Due to reasons for growth and expansion, they have moved into a building that 14,000 sq ft roughly 2 years ago and have experienced this continued growth trend ever since. The seller is willing to carry or roll equity at 15% to show his vested interest in the continued success of the business moving forward Priced at $5,500,000, this business comes with a proven history, a tenured staff, and reliable client base, allowing for a buyer to step in and continue operating and growing successfully from day one. Growth opportunities include continuing to follow GCs to high net-worth areas like Hawaii.
